AUTOMATION TESTING FRAMEWORKS: STREAMLINING INTRICATE TESTING CIRCUMSTANCES

Automation Testing Frameworks: Streamlining Intricate Testing Circumstances

Automation Testing Frameworks: Streamlining Intricate Testing Circumstances

Blog Article

The Future of Software Application Development: Using the Prospective of Automation Testing for Faster, More Dependable Releases



In the world of software application growth, the mission for faster, extra reliable launches has long been a central emphasis. As innovation developments and customer assumptions develop, the duty of automation screening in achieving these objectives has ended up being increasingly noticeable - automation testing. The prospective advantages of automation testing are huge, promising not just to accelerate launch cycles however additionally to improve the total top quality and consistency of software. In a landscape where rate and accuracy are critical, taking advantage of the capacities of automation testing stands as a crucial method for staying in advance.


The Power of Automation Checking



In the world of software program growth, the execution of automation testing has shown to substantially improve performance and high quality assurance processes. By automating repeated and lengthy manual screening tasks, software program groups can enhance their screening initiatives, minimize human mistakes, and accelerate the general advancement lifecycle. Automation testing permits the quick implementation of test cases across different atmospheres and arrangements, supplying developers with fast responses on the quality of their code changes.


Among the crucial advantages of automation testing is its capability to boost examination coverage, guaranteeing that even more attributes and capabilities are completely evaluated. This detailed testing strategy aids recognize flaws early in the growth cycle, minimizing the possibility of pricey bugs reaching production. Automation testing promotes constant integration and continual distribution practices, enabling teams to release software application updates much more often and accurately.


Accelerating Release Cycles



The velocity of release cycles in software growth is critical for staying affordable in the quickly developing technology landscape. Reducing the time between launches allows firms to respond swiftly to market needs, incorporate individual feedback quickly, and outmatch competitors in supplying cutting-edge functions. By leveraging and embracing active approaches automation testing devices, development groups can streamline their procedures, identify insects earlier, and make sure a better item with each launch.


Speeding up release cycles likewise makes it possible for software application companies to preserve a competitive edge by promptly attending to security susceptabilities and adapting to changing regulatory demands. In addition, constant launches assist in structure consumer trust and loyalty as users benefit from continuous renovations and pest solutions. This repetitive approach promotes a culture of continuous improvement within development teams, urging cooperation, innovation, and a concentrate on delivering worth to end-users.


Guaranteeing Consistent Quality Assurance



Regular high quality assurance includes an i was reading this organized method to screening and evaluating software program to recognize and correct any kind of concerns or problems without delay. This includes defining clear top quality criteria, conducting thorough screening at each stage of advancement, and leveraging automation screening devices to streamline the process.


Conquering Common Testing Challenges



Resolving and solving usual testing challenges is necessary for ensuring the performance and effectiveness of software program development procedures. This issue can be minimized by complete test preparation, integrating diverse testing methods, and leveraging automation testing to boost coverage. In addition, collaborating screening efforts across various groups and departments can present a challenge due to communication spaces and varying top priorities.


Executing Automation Examining Techniques



automation testingautomation testing
Having actually efficiently browsed typical testing challenges, the following calculated focus exists in efficiently applying automation testing to optimize software program growth processes. Automation screening approaches include using specialized frameworks and devices to automate repeated tasks, lower hands-on treatment, i thought about this and boost the speed and precision of testing. To carry out automation screening properly, a detailed strategy needs to be established, starting with determining the right test cases for automation based on criteria such as regularity of intricacy, criticality, and usage.




When the examination cases are picked, teams ought to spend time in designing robust examination scripts that are maintainable, recyclable, and scalable. Cooperation between stakeholders, testers, and developers is vital to ensure that the automation testing lines up with the general job goals and demands. Constant combination and release pipes can further streamline the automation screening procedure by instantly triggering tests whenever new code is committed. By pop over to this site embracing automation screening approaches, software advancement teams can achieve quicker checking cycles, greater examination insurance coverage, and inevitably supply even more trusted software releases.


Verdict



In verdict, automation screening offers a powerful device for increasing launch cycles, making sure consistent quality guarantee, and overcoming typical testing obstacles in software application development. By using the capacity of automation testing techniques, organizations can attain faster and extra trusted releases. automation testing. Welcoming automation testing is crucial for remaining competitive in the busy world of software program development


automation testingautomation testing
By automating repeated and lengthy manual testing tasks, software groups can simplify their screening initiatives, decrease human mistakes, and accelerate the overall development lifecycle.Having successfully browsed usual screening obstacles, the following calculated focus lies in successfully applying automation testing to maximize software program advancement processes. Automation testing approaches entail the use of specialized devices and structures to automate recurring tasks, reduce hand-operated intervention, and increase the rate and accuracy of screening. To carry out automation testing effectively, a thorough technique ought to be established, starting with identifying the appropriate examination instances for automation based on requirements such as frequency of use, intricacy, and criticality.


In conclusion, automation screening offers an effective tool for increasing release cycles, guaranteeing consistent high quality guarantee, and getting rid of common screening challenges in software application growth.

Report this page